Judgment text excerpt

The Supreme Court clarified that Section 630 of the Companies Act, 1956 criminalizes the wrongful retention of company property by both current and former officers or employees after termination of employment. The Court held that the term 'officer or employee' includes those whose employment has ended, thereby overruling the Calcutta High Court's interpretation in Amrit Lal Chum v. Devi Ranjan Jha. The Court emphasized that wrongful withholding of property post-employment constitutes an offence under Section 630(1).
